Sandbox "Zero To Hero" RPG in futuristic setting. Game features deep economic gameplay with realistic economy and full freedom for a player.
While on a planet, range of opportunities is wide, from being employed practically at any building (should there be a vacancy) to owning any non-government building, influencing economy directly. Entire planet economy is based on real buildings present in the game and therefore player can shape it to his liking (if player is rich enough). Player can also choose to be anyone - from local business owner, to criminal or politician (or as it might often be - all at once). Skill development is only possible if player performs tasks which require those skills.
Player can travel from planet to planet and own or rent any spaceship, mining, pirating or simply trading goods between planets. While game has no quests & restrictions, there is a main story present which implies that player need to achieve certain results and actions to meet win condition, which does not stop player from continuing game thereafter.
Choose any path or all at once. Model employee, Business owner, Politician, Merchant, Pirate, Criminal, or just explore game as it feels.
Star Life needs at least NVidia GTX 1050 / AMD RX550 and 8 GB RAM.
Minimum
OS
Windows 10 64bit
Processor
Intel Core i5 2.5 GHz / AMD Ryzen 5
Memory
8 GB RAM
Graphics
NVidia GTX 1050 / AMD RX550
DirectX
Version 10
Storage
5 GB available space
Recommended
OS
Windows 10 64bit
Processor
Intel Core i7 2.8 GHz / AMD Ryzen 7
Memory
16 GB RAM
Graphics
NVidia GTX 1080 / AMD RX 5600
DirectX
Version 10
Storage
5 GB available space
